Thangka of Buddha Shakyamuni and the 16 Arhats, Tibet, 19th/20th Century,
pigment with water soluble binding agent on fabric, gold paint, at the centre is Shakyamuni in meditation pose on a lotus base, flanked by his disciples Shariputra and Maudgalyayana, he looks at a retinue of figures below, with the 16 arhats sitting all around him, image size 70 x 49,5 cm, with brocade border 109 x 62 cm, a few areas (unnecessarily) restored
